Foundation Engineering Design of Shallow Foundations

EXAMPLE-1
Design a rectangular isolated footing for the data given below.

 Service Load (including self-weight); P = 1700KN, Mx = 107KNm, My = 55KNm


 Design Load; P = 2400KN, Mx = 150KNm, My = 78KNm
 Allowable bearing capacity of the soil is 200KPa
 Take L=1.2B
 Use concrete grade of C30/37 and rebar grade of S-460.
 Available rebar size is Ø20.

SOLUTION
PART-I: PROPORTIONING
 Applied service load: P = 1700KN, Mx = 107KNm, My = 55KNm
 Soil bearing capacity: qall = 200KPa
 Footing is rectangular with: L = 1.2B
1) Footing size from σmax ≤ qall
